Hi all, this morning on my is200 the oil warning light stayed on for about a mile and then went off. It did the same when I came home from work. Checked the oil level which is fine. Anyone got any ideas ??

It's unusual to have the oil pressure light come on with a cold engine as the oil is thicker when cold and thinner when hot so that is normally when the pressure falls.

I take it the oil/filter service is up to date and you are using the correct type/grade of oil and preferably an OEM filter.

Was the car on level ground when you checked the level?

What is your current mileage?

It could be a faulty sender unit or defective wiring to it, may be an idea to actually check the pressure with an oil pressure gauge or ask your local garage to check it for you.

it is either a faulty pressure sender unit/wiring or you actually have low oil pressure. I would get it checked out, will only take a garage a few minutes to check the oil pressure.

For the IS200 it should be 7.3 psi or higher at idle and between 46 - 64 psi at 3,000 rpm.

I use magnatec 5W-30 A1 fully synthetic oil (don't think this is the correct oil) and a filter form Camberley autos, the car was level. Had the car 9 years and never had any problems. always service by myself every 12 months. just wondered if the hot weather has something to do with it. I will take it to a garage and get the pressure checked.

that oil is fine.

Some of the non OEM filters don't have an anti-drain valve in them and therefore pressure isn't built up as fast but it should only take a few seconds at most for the light to go out.
